The clock struck midnight, and the moon cast an eerie glow over the quaint village of Shimmerwood. Detective Elara Vane stood at the edge of the old, creaking bridge that spanned the Silverstream. The air was thick with the scent of night-blooming flowers and the hum of unseen magic. She had been chasing a lead for days, one that seemed to stretch into the realm of the impossible.

The village was a quaint place, nestled between rolling hills and dense forests. It was said that the land was enchanted, with secrets waiting to be uncovered by those who dared to seek them. Elara, with her sharp wit and keen eye for detail, was one such seeker.

It all began when she received a cryptic letter from an unknown sender. The letter spoke of a magical artifact, hidden deep within the heart of the forest, that held the power to control the very fabric of reality. The sender had seen visions of the artifact being used to bring about an era of darkness, and it was up to Elara to stop it.

Her quest had led her through the dense undergrowth, past ancient stone circles, and into the heart of the enchanted forest. There, she had encountered a motley crew of magical beings, each with their own tale and reason for seeking the artifact. But the closer she got, the more elusive it seemed to become.

Elara had no choice but to rely on her instincts and the trust she had built with her newfound allies. Among them was Kaito, a young wizard with a knack for finding hidden paths and deciphering ancient texts. He had been searching for the artifact for years, driven by a personal vendetta against the dark sorcerer who had taken his family from him.

As they ventured deeper into the forest, they discovered that the artifact was not just a physical object, but a conundrum, a riddle that could only be solved by those who possessed the purest of hearts. The forest itself seemed to guard the artifact, presenting them with trials that tested their resolve, courage, and love.

One such trial was the Labyrinth of Whispers, a maze of trees that spoke in voices that could drive a person mad. Elara and Kaito had to navigate through the labyrinth, listening to the voices and choosing their path with care. The voices grew louder, more insistent, until Elara realized that the true test was not their ability to listen, but their ability to trust each other.

In the heart of the labyrinth, Elara found herself at a crossroads. One path led to the artifact, but it was lined with the voices of those she had lost, calling out to her from the shadows. The other path led to Kaito, who was facing his own trial, a test of his resolve to seek justice for his family.

Elara made the difficult choice to leave Kaito to face his own battle and followed the voices to the artifact. As she reached the artifact, she found herself confronted by the dark sorcerer, who had been watching her every move. The sorcerer revealed that he had been manipulating the forest all along, using Elara's own emotions against her.

In a moment of truth, Elara realized that the key to solving the conundrum was not the artifact itself, but the love and trust she had built with Kaito. With a newfound clarity, she confronted the sorcerer, using her own magic to banish him from the forest.

The forest seemed to sigh with relief as the darkness lifted. Elara and Kaito returned to the village, the artifact safely in their possession, but the true victory was the bond they had forged. The village was saved, and the world was one step closer to peace.

In the end, Elara realized that the greatest enigma was not the artifact, but the strength that lay within her own heart. It was a lesson she would carry with her forever, a reminder that the most powerful magic is the magic of love and trust.

As the sun rose over the horizon, casting a golden glow over the village, Elara and Kaito stood side by side, ready to face whatever mysteries the future might hold. The Enchanted Enigma had been solved, but the adventure was just beginning.
